Transaction ea2225c790677da6ec3bde67254356926ca29cf5dccc21190f34afbc4fbe2cbe
1 Input
1 Output
-
ea2225c790677da6ec3bde67254356926ca29cf5dccc21190f34afbc4fbe2cbe:0
- value
- 521853
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6de237f06ad39ae83eadbc7b0aeaea634772221 OP_EQUAL
- address
- 3QCLGCU3UtpgDu7AqoinVkxWihYVVDpbJY